Position Details
The Psychiatric Technician will:
* administer medication and therapeutic treatments, monitor for potential side effects and report
* provide care in a manner that considers the patient's rights, safety, comfort and the overall therapeutic environment
* observe, document and report resident behavior
* monitor and document weights, blood pressure, pulse and respiration per MD orders and monthly for all residents
* communicate with co-workers and supervisors in a timely manner that affects patient care or well-being
* fill in resident charts
* assist in orientation and training of new staff members, understand, and implement Merakey policies and procedures
* order refills of medications,
* act as lead staff when the Administrator or Asst. Administrator is not available.
* complete all other duties as assigned by the Administrator.
